Curve 57222a4

57222 = 2 · 32 · 11 · 172



Data for elliptic curve 57222a4

Field Data Notes
Atkin-Lehner 2+ 3+ 11+ 17+ Signs for the Atkin-Lehner involutions
Class 57222a Isogeny class
Conductor 57222 Conductor
∏ cp 16 Product of Tamagawa factors cp
Δ 3679172623735488 = 26 · 39 · 112 · 176 Discriminant
Eigenvalues 2+ 3+  0 -2 11+  2 17+  2 Hecke eigenvalues for primes up to 20
Equation [1,-1,0,-2665212,-1674065008] [a1,a2,a3,a4,a6]
Generators [-16548506:7746539:17576] Generators of the group modulo torsion
j 4406910829875/7744 j-invariant
L 3.7699619512158 L(r)(E,1)/r!
Ω 0.11815895810681 Real period
R 7.9764624106572 Regulator
r 1 Rank of the group of rational points
S 0.9999999999815 (Analytic) order of Ш
t 2 Number of elements in the torsion subgroup
Twists 57222bf2 198d4 Quadratic twists by: -3 17
